Transaction 294a76b80bcd636ee114f01005c438ef106ce2d587f84afed266aa41a954f622
2 Input
2 Outputs
- 294a76b80bcd636ee114f01005c438ef106ce2d587f84afed266aa41a954f622:0
- 294a76b80bcd636ee114f01005c438ef106ce2d587f84afed266aa41a954f622:1
value 4096698
address 32aHnthas12qXL8sVMnBEnvUsYPrsKZXZM
value 302102057
address 3KivdykwQLUCJKffpYRy6Pqiwz6tA8HLyv